Looking For A New Browser? - Your Power Web Browser
SponsoredStreamline everything you do and access thousands of apps without leaving your br…View Features · Explore Resources · Add your extensions · Manage your tabs
View Features · Explore Resources · Add your extensions · Manage your tabs
Feedback